New Adobe PDF Zero-Day Flaw Under Attack

Adobe today sounded an alarm for a new zero-day flaw in its PDF Reader/Acrobat software, warning that hackers are actively exploiting the vulnerability in-the-wild. Details on the vulnerability are not yet public but the sudden warning from Adobe is a sure sign that rigged PDF documents are being used by malicious hackers to take complete control of machines with the latest versions of Adobe Reader/acrobat installed. Adobe said it cannot offer any pre-patch advice to help users thwart the attacks. It targets Windows users, affects Acrobat 8 and 9, exploits multiple versions at once and bypasses DEP and ASLR.
